LTC3454 Series
The LTC3454 is a synchronous buck-boost DC/DC converter optimized for driving a single high power LED at currents up to 1A from a single cell Li-Ion battery input. The regulator operates in either synchronous buck, synchronous boost, or buck-boost mode depending on input voltage and LED forward voltage. PLED/PINefficiency greater than 90% can be achieved over the entire usable range of a Li-Ion battery (2.7V to 4.2V).LED current is programmable to one of four levels, including shutdown, with dual external resistors and dual enable inputs. In shutdown no supply current is drawn.A high constant operating frequency of 1MHz allows the use of small external components.The LTC3454 is offered in a low profile (0.75mm) thermally enhanced 10-lead (3mm × 3mm) DFN package.ApplicationsCell Phone Camera FlashCell Phone Torch LightingDigital CamerasPDAsMisc Li-Ion LED Drivers
Technical Specifications
Parameters and characteristics for this part
| Specification | LTC3454EDD#PBF |
|---|---|
| Applications | Camera Flash |
| Current - Output / Channel | 1 A |
| Frequency | 1 MHz |
| Internal Switch(s) | Yes |
| Mounting Type | Surface Mount |
| Number of Outputs | 1 |
| Operating Temperature (Max) | 85 °C |
| Operating Temperature (Min) | -40 °C |
| Package / Case | 10-WFDFN Exposed Pad |
| Package Length | 3 mm |
| Package Name | 10-DFN |
| Package Width | 3 mm |
| Topology | Step-Up (Boost), Step-Down (Buck) |
| Type | DC DC Regulator |
| Voltage - Output | 5.15 V |
| Voltage - Supply (Max) | 5.5 V |
| Voltage - Supply (Min) | 2.7 V |
